Explain the concept of storytelling in personal branding and how it can create an emotional connection with the audience.
Storytelling in personal branding is a powerful and effective technique that involves crafting and sharing authentic narratives to connect with an audience on a deeper, emotional level. It goes beyond merely presenting facts and accomplishments; it delves into the personal experiences, struggles, and triumphs of the individual behind the brand. By employing storytelling, individuals can create a compelling and relatable brand image that resonates with their target audience.
1. Authenticity and Relatability: Personal branding through storytelling allows individuals to showcase their authentic selves. By sharing personal stories, vulnerabilities, and challenges, they become more relatable to their audience. People are naturally drawn to stories that mirror their own experiences, and this fosters a sense of trust and empathy.
2. Emotional Connection: Stories have the power to evoke emotions, and emotions play a significant role in decision-making. When personal stories are shared, they can trigger empathy, joy, inspiration, or even nostalgia in the audience. This emotional connection deepens the relationship between the individual and their audience, making them more invested in the person behind the brand.
3. Building Trust and Credibility: Storytelling humanizes the personal brand, and a human connection is vital for building trust. When individuals share their journey, including the challenges they've overcome and the lessons they've learned, it showcases their expertise and builds credibility in their field. It demonstrates that they understand their audience's pain points and have the solutions to address them.
4. Memorability: Facts and data can be forgotten, but stories are memorable. When individuals use storytelling in their personal branding, it helps them stand out from competitors who might have similar skills or qualifications. A well-crafted story has a lasting impact, making the individual and their brand more memorable to the audience.
5. Differentiation: In a crowded market, personal branding through storytelling becomes a powerful tool for differentiation. No one else has the same unique life experiences and perspective as the individual, and by sharing these stories, they set themselves apart and create a niche that is uniquely theirs.
6. Inspiration and Aspiration: Personal stories can inspire others who may be facing similar challenges or pursuing similar goals. When individuals share their journey to success, it encourages others to believe in their own potential and strive for greatness. It creates a sense of aspiration and motivation within the audience.
7. Cultural and Societal Impact: Storytelling can transcend personal boundaries and address broader societal issues. By sharing stories that highlight social causes or advocate for positive change, individuals can use their personal brand to contribute to a larger movement and positively impact society.
In conclusion, storytelling in personal branding is an artful way to communicate who you are, what you stand for, and why your audience should care about your journey. It forges an emotional bond with the audience, establishes trust and credibility, and sets you apart from the competition. By harnessing the power of storytelling, individuals can create a lasting and impactful personal brand that resonates with their audience on a deeper level.
